Every surgeon is different so it is hard to say but what I had done before they scheduled me for surgery was:
(OK, forgive the miss spelled words )
Phyc Eval
Cardiologist appt (stress test, EKG, Eco)
Endocrinologist (thyroid check)
Pulmonalogist (sleep test if needed, visit)
Gastro Dr (scope)
Nutritionist
PCP clearance
OK I think that was it.....after I did all those and got back the results we were ready to schedule my date. That took about 3 weeks to get date and Ins Approval.

As Deb said every surgeon is different. I had to have:
Psych. Evaluation
Nutritionist
Cardiologist (EKG, Echocardiogram & Stress Test)
Ultrasound of Gall Bladder
Thyroid Blood Work
Breathing Test & Sleep Study (if necessary)
Upper GI Series
Endoscopy
PCP clearance
After all the test were done, I got a surgery date and then the surgeon put in for insurance approval. About a week before surgery, I had to go to the hospital for pre-surgical testing (blood work, medical history and chest x-ray).

it varies, it depends on your doctor and your health. my doctor required a letter from my pcp, a psch evaluation, 2 visists to the nutristionist, a gall bladder test, and i had to do a test were i had to drink barium and my doctor looked at my digestive tract and stomache (the name escapes me). pretty much that's all i was required to do.
